Say Hello to the MOTO Z10, sporting UIQ 3.2

07 January 2008

The new MOTO Z10 is a complete, pocket-sized, mobile film studio and is a stylish kick slider that makes it easy to capture high-quality video, edit clips, create transitions between scenes and add title slides and a soundtrack. In addition to creating videos, MOTO Z10 features great media playback capabilities and has a 3.2 megapixel camera capturing up to three images a second. The MOTO Z10 has a crystal-clear 2.2" QVGA screen that displays video at 30 frames per second in millions of colors and comes with 3.5G HSDPA, GSM/GPRS/EDGE.

The MOTO Z10 is based on UIQ 3.2 that was unveiled today as well.

UIQ 3.2 is an upgrade of UIQ 3.1 and is intended for the phone manufactures, adding new features and customization options to the UIQ Platform, for instance OMA Email Notification 1.0, OMA IMPS 1.2 for instant messaging, MMS postcard, extended customization possibilities of the Application Launcher and support for some additional Java Specification Requests (SR-248).

This additions the UIQ Platform are beneficial to UIQ's licensees, the phone manufacturers, and, ultimately, the users of the phones based on UIQ 3.2, but will not impact third party developers: since no new public application programming interface (API) has been added in this version of UIQ, no new Software Development Kit (SDK) will be issued for third parties.

This means that UIQ 3 applications that were and will be developed using the UIQ 3.0 or UIQ 3.1 SDKs will also work on phones based on UIQ 3.2, as UIQ 3.2 is fully compatible with UIQ 3.1 and doesn't require new tools or software to build applications for the phones using it.
